As of June 2026, 26 home improvement grant, rebate, and forgivable loan programs are open to homeowners in Kingsland, TX, with individual awards up to $200,000. 6 programs target seniors, 3 serve veterans, and 16 require no income limit.

💡 Stack programs to maximize your savings

Many of these programs can be combined. For example, you can use a city repair grant for the work, a utility rebate for the energy savings, and a federal tax credit on top, all for the same project.
